Below is the text of the message I sent to PayPal...  I recommend others do likewise. Visit their feedback page ,
select "Protections/Privacy/Security" on the left column, then "User Agreement" on the right.


Many of your restrictions are based on federal laws.  However, this from your AUP may now be outdated: " You may not use PayPal to sell or advertise high capacity magazines (magazines that can hold more than 10 rounds)."  Please see the following excerpt from BATF website: http://www.atf.gov/firearms/saw-faqs.htm

Q: Was the LCAFD (Large Capacity Ammunition Feeding Device - aka "Magazine") ban permanent?
A: No. ... Therefore, effective 12:01 a.m. on September 13, 2004, the provisions of the law will cease to apply.

Please consider lifting your prohibition on these legal products.  Thank you!
